代码之家  ›  专栏  ›  技术社区  ›  brycemcd

Git如何找到分支起源的提交哈希

  •  46
  • brycemcd  · 技术社区  · 14 年前

    假设我从主分支分支分支到主题分支,然后在主题分支上做了一些提交。是否有一个命令告诉我主题分支源于主分支上的提交哈希?

    理想情况下,我不需要知道我做了多少承诺(试图避免头部^5)。

    我在谷歌上搜索过,到处都是,似乎无法找到答案。谢谢!

    3 回复  |  直到 6 年前
        1
  •  42
  •   isherwood    8 年前

    git merge-base master your-branch

        2
  •  63
  •   max    14 年前

    git reflog show --no-abbrev <branch name> xxx master

    bdbf21b087de5aa2e78a7d793e035d8bd9ec9629 xxx@{0}: branch: Created from master
    

        3
  •  0
  •   Rick Wildes    6 年前